Usuário com melhor resposta
Erro NF-E versão 2.0 - Código de Rejeição 411

Pergunta
-
Olá, estou fazendo testes na NF-E 2.0 no ax, porém, quando eu envio, rejeita com o seguinte código e informação:
411 - Rejeição: Campo versaoDados inexistente no elemento nfeCabecMsg do SOAP Header
Porém, se eu for em consulta, mensagem xml, e valido no validador da receita do site do RS, ele dá como lote OK.
Alguém sabe o que pode estar errado?
Obrigado
Rafael
Respostas
-
Rafael,
Tive este problema (AX2009 RU5), abri um chamado e deve estar sendo resolvido nas próximas versões. Como não podia esperar fui orientado a fazer uma alteração em um dos métodos da classe responsável por gerar o xml da NFe. Fiz a alteração e funcionou bem. Segue abaixo o que eu fiz:
classe: EFDocMsgTransport_WebServiceV4_BR
método: creageMessageHeader
onde estava:
setPropertyValue(#version,xmlFormatVersion);
mudei para:
setPropertyValue(#version,webServiceSetup.Version);
Espero que te ajude. Também tive um outro problema com o CNPJ/CPF. Se precisar de alguma coisa me avise.
Como não pode faltar: DISCLAIMER, fiz este procedimento e funcionou para mim, não significa que funcione em outras instalações. O conteúdo é "AS-IS", sem garantias ou direitos. Use por sua conta e risco.
- Marcado como Resposta Rafael R Cardoso segunda-feira, 6 de dezembro de 2010 11:16
-
Olá Rafael. Tive esse problema também aqui na empresa. Foi necessário a abertura de um chamado técnico na Microsoft , que reconheceu o problema, mas ainda não anunciou a correção.
Adeilson
- Marcado como Resposta Rafael R Cardoso segunda-feira, 6 de dezembro de 2010 11:16
Todas as Respostas
-
Olá Rafael. Tive esse problema também aqui na empresa. Foi necessário a abertura de um chamado técnico na Microsoft , que reconheceu o problema, mas ainda não anunciou a correção.
Adeilson
- Marcado como Resposta Rafael R Cardoso segunda-feira, 6 de dezembro de 2010 11:16
-
Rafael,
Tive este problema (AX2009 RU5), abri um chamado e deve estar sendo resolvido nas próximas versões. Como não podia esperar fui orientado a fazer uma alteração em um dos métodos da classe responsável por gerar o xml da NFe. Fiz a alteração e funcionou bem. Segue abaixo o que eu fiz:
classe: EFDocMsgTransport_WebServiceV4_BR
método: creageMessageHeader
onde estava:
setPropertyValue(#version,xmlFormatVersion);
mudei para:
setPropertyValue(#version,webServiceSetup.Version);
Espero que te ajude. Também tive um outro problema com o CNPJ/CPF. Se precisar de alguma coisa me avise.
Como não pode faltar: DISCLAIMER, fiz este procedimento e funcionou para mim, não significa que funcione em outras instalações. O conteúdo é "AS-IS", sem garantias ou direitos. Use por sua conta e risco.
- Marcado como Resposta Rafael R Cardoso segunda-feira, 6 de dezembro de 2010 11:16
-
Pessoal, boa tarde. Não sei se isso pode ajudá-los, mas no link abaixo existe um hotfix para download:
axfordummies.com/2011/01/erro-nf-e-versao-2-0-codigo-de-rejeicao-411/
Abs.